Brian Thompson. Owner

Mr. Thompson focuses his practice on representing individuals and businesses who seek bankruptcy counsel. He has represented a wide range of debtors  including individuals with little to no income, family farmers, and businesses with annual revenues ranging from thousands to millions of dollars.

He has successfully represented debtors under the Federal Bankruptcy Code in Chapter 7, Chapter 11, Chapter 12 and Chapter 13 cases.
